business procedure modelling and digitization toolbox - master thesis - kamalika dutta

Post on 22-Jan-2018

261 Views

Category:

Technology

4 Downloads

Preview:

Click to see full reader

TRANSCRIPT

Wer die Digitalisierung verschläft, erleidet Schiffbruch.

Ohne Digitalisierung keine Zukunft! - Martin Fuchs, Caritas Digital

Business Procedure Modelling

and Digitization Toolbox

Kamalika Dutta

Master Thesis

Supervisors: Prof. Dr. Wolfgang Prinz

Prof. Dr. Thomas Rose

Overview

o Introduction and Motivation

o Research Goals

o Related Work

o Concept

o Implementation

o Demo

o Evaluation

o Conclusion

o Outlook

3

Introductionand

Motivation

4

Digitization

Courtesy: Alle-reden-von-Digitalisierung-wir-machen-das, einfach-online-arbeiten.de 5

Digitization, aka. Digitalization is the use of digital

technologies to enhance a business model and provide new

revenue and value-producing opportunities; it is the process

of moving a business from the physical to the digital world.

(Gartner, Inc., 2012)

Disruptive Technologies

Brian Solis, Altimeter Digital Transformation report Fred Wilson, The Golden Triangle 6

Business Procedure Model

7

A business procedure model is a flow diagram, that provides step by

step procedural description of one operational instance of an

enterprise’s business model.

Research Goals

8

Aim

To develop and evaluate a business procedure

modelling tool that supports the association and

mapping of business procedure elements to digital

services to enable digitization.

9

Research Questions

1. How can a platform be developed for the conversion of traditional

business procedure models into models enhanced by digital

services?

2. How can a tool be developed that supports the mapping of

business procedure elements to digital services?

3. Can the gap between technology providers and business model

designers be bridged effectively by providing one platform for

both?

10

Related Work

11

Related Work > Sources

12

Conference

Proceedings

Academic

Research

reports,

dissertations

Journals,

Articles,

Books

Corporate

Reports,

White Paper

Digital Media,

Tech Blogs,

Internet

Technology and

Business

Magazines

Related Work > Categories

13

Examples of

Digitally Enhanced

Business

Procedure Models

Business Model

Diagramming Tools

Business

Procedure

Modelling

Techniques

Related Work >

Conclusions

14

— Missing actionable approaches: Extant literature does not provide

actionable approaches for business models in inter-connected IoT-

enabled business environments.

— Missing Methods/Tools for conversion of existing traditional business

procedure models into digital business procedure models.

— Missing platform for digital service providers to make their services

available for business modelling.

Concept

15

Target Users

16

Business Procedure Modelling

17

Digital Services Management

18

19

Use-Case ScenarioOn-demand Healthcare

Courtesy: Shutterstock 20

Immediate attention

Minimises avoidable

tests

Simplifies scheduling

appointments

Better health monitoring

On-demand Healthcare

Courtesy: Freepik 21

Business Procedure Model

22

Proposal of Digital Services

23

Selection of services

24

Digitization

25

Implementation

26

Low Fidelity Paper Prototypes

27

Medium Fidelity PrototypesUI Mockups

28

Web Application

29

System Architecture

30

Modules

31

Technologies and Frameworks

• Software Package Management: NPM, Bower

• Front-end:

• Technologies: HTML/HTML5, CSS, JavaScript

• MV Framework: AngularJS

• Authorization: Passport

• Back-end:

• Technology: Node.JS

• Framework: Express

• Architecture: REST

• Scaffolding tool: Yeoman

• Build tools: Gulp.js, Uglify.js, Browserify

• Testing: Karma, Jasmine, Protractor, PhantomJS,

• Database: NoSQL: MongoDB

32

Technologies and

FrameworksFront-end

Business Logic

Database

33

Prototyping

Diagramming

Performance

Testing

User Interface

Components

34

User Interface

Dashboard

35

User Interface

Navigation

36

User Interface

Projects

37

User Interface

Business Procedure Modelling

38

User Interface

Digitization

39

User Interface

Activities

40

User Interface

Create/Edit Activity

41

User InterfaceServices | Create/Edit Service

42

43

Demo

Evaluation

44

Overview of Evaluation Methods

45

User Study

User Study

46

Workshop - BPM Digitized by Target User

- Accommodation Renting and Lodging

47

Workshop - BPM Digitized by Target User

- Moving on-demand

48

Workshop - BPM Digitized by Target User

- Borrowing/Lending Items

49

50

Workshop - BPM Digitized by Target User

- Emergency Healthcare

User Study Feedback

51

Feedback Questionnaire with Likert-scale responses.

𝑚𝑒𝑎𝑛 = ((# 𝑟𝑒𝑠𝑝𝑜𝑛𝑠𝑒 1) ∗ (𝑣𝑎𝑙𝑢𝑒 𝑟𝑒𝑠𝑝𝑜𝑛𝑠𝑒 1) + (# 𝑟𝑒𝑠𝑝𝑜𝑛𝑠𝑒 2) ∗(𝑣𝑎𝑙𝑢𝑒 𝑟𝑒𝑠𝑝𝑜𝑛𝑠𝑒 2)… (# 𝑟𝑒𝑠𝑝𝑜𝑛𝑠𝑒 𝑛) ∗ (𝑣𝑎𝑙𝑢𝑒 𝑟𝑒𝑠𝑝𝑜𝑛𝑠𝑒 𝑛)])/(𝑡𝑜𝑡𝑎𝑙 𝑛𝑢𝑚𝑏𝑒𝑟 𝑜𝑓 𝑝𝑎𝑟𝑡𝑖𝑐𝑖𝑝𝑎𝑛𝑡𝑠)

Total Participants: 10

6 General Users

4 Target Users

Feedback Likert-Scale Data

52

Strongly disagree(1)

Disagree(2)

Neutral(3)

Agree(4)

Strongly agree(5)

The App allowed you to create a Business Procedure Model easily?

#

%

mean

0 0 2 3 5

0% 0% 20% 30% 50%

4.3

You were able to successfully digitize your BPM?

#

%

mean

0 0 1 4 5

0% 0% 10% 40% 50%

4.4

You were satisfied with the proposed digital services.

#

%

mean

1 1 3 3 2

10% 10% 30% 30% 20%

3.4

Would you recommend this App to others?

#

%

mean

0 0 0 6 4

0% 0% 0% 60% 40%

4.4

The App was easy to navigate and user-friendly.

#

%

mean

0 0 0 3 7

0% 0% 0% 30% 70%

4.7

Overall Rating. #

%

mean

0 0 0 7 3

10% 10% 30% 30% 20%

4.3

User feedback > Functionality

53

User feedback > Usability

54

User feedback > Suggestions

55

Conclusion

A business procedure modelling and digitization tool called Digitizer

developed to digitize existing BPMs.

Digitizer evaluated to prove that it achieves all the research goals

set by this thesis.

Bridged the gap between businesses and the digital technology

providers.

56

Outlook > Functionalities

57

• Domain-based Matching:– Domains: Logistics | Health | Education | Travel & Hotel | E-Commerce

– When tag-based matching generates no matching services, prompt user to match by Domain to find better results.

• Request Service:– Let user ‘Request for service’ when expected services is missing.

– Maintain list of requested services.

– Digital Service Providers refer to ‘Requested Service’ and add services.

• User behavior comments:– User selects a service that was not suggested by the system or not

generated as a result of the tag-based mapping, ‘ask user to comment on his actions’

– Prompt user to update tags.

• Allowing reordering of activities

Outlook > Functionalities

58

• Record Usage Statistics and provide recommendations to user

during service selection.

• Gamify the adding of activities and services to improve quality of

tagging.

• Visualize the mapping of activities and services via tags.

• Improve Services view to an explorer like interface.

Outlook > Concepts

59

• Taxonomy for activity creation

• BPMs as services

• BPMs as Pedagogical models

Important Links

• App Demo:

https://digitizer-test.herokuapp.com/

• Code Repository:

https://github.com/Kamalika1912/Digitizer-v1.0

60

Thank you!

top related